Abstract

Papers (1928-1973) of Ukrainian American author Dokiia Kuzmiwna Humenna (b. 1904) consist of two scrapbooks. Included are book reviews, publication announcements, epigrams, correspondence, and miscellany.

HISTORICAL SKETCH

Dokiia Kuzmiwna Humenna (b. 1904) was born in Zhashkev, Ukraine. She studied literature at the University of Kiev, graduating in 1926. She became a U.S. citizen in 1959. Humenna was active in Ukrainian American organizations, and was a prolific author.
